White Feminism Book Description

White Feminism offers readers a fresh look at modern feminist thought through clear language and vivid examples. This English title is available at Kalimat Bookstore Online, where it promises a compelling reading experience for anyone interested in social change. Readers will quickly see how the author blends personal stories with broader cultural analysis, making complex ideas easy to follow.

The story moves through three main parts. The first part examines the origins of feminist movements and how race has shaped their direction. Meanwhile, the second part highlights contemporary challenges faced by women of color within mainstream activism. Additionally, the final section suggests practical steps for building a more inclusive movement. Throughout, the author uses accessible language, so the book feels like a conversation rather than a lecture.

Fans of social justice literature will appreciate the book’s balanced tone. The guide does not shy away from difficult topics, yet it provides hope and actionable advice. Moreover, each chapter ends with reflection questions that invite readers to apply the concepts to their own lives. This interactive element helps turn theory into personal growth.
